JOHN 3:34-36
34 For he whom God hath sent speaketh the words of God: for God giveth not the Spirit by measure unto him.
35 The Father loveth the Son, and hath given all things into his hand.
36 He that believeth on the Son hath everlasting life: and he that believeth not the Son shall not see life; but the wrath of God abideth on him.
"For he whom God hath sent..."
God the Father sent His Son to this fallen world. I can't even begin to imagine what it must have been like for the LORD Jesus - to leave the holy atmosphere of Heaven, with all of its purity, glory and goodness and come to this dank, depressing, lost world reeking with putrid sin and corruption. Nevertheless, He came and willingly so, out of a heart of love for us!

PUTTING IT INTO PRACTICE - The Dichotomy in Our Society
Charles Spurgeon was once told that by a visitor to his church, and he replied by saying,
"Come join the church anyway, what's one more hypocrite going to matter!"
The fact is that we all have a tendency towards hypocrisy to one degree or another; it's a part of the Human condition. All of us are tempted and even succumb to the lure of putting on an act so that people will believe better about us than we actually are.
In fact, the very word hypocrite is from the Greek word 'hippocrites' which means 'actor'.
There are many professing Christians today who claim to believe the Bible, adhering intellectually to its doctrines, and seem to follow Jesus - they know all the 'Christianese' phrases and words. And yet upon close examination, their lives are a poor reflection of what the LORD intends for His saints.

JOHN 3:19-21
19 And this is the condemnation, that light is come into the world, and men loved darkness rather than light, because their deeds were evil.
20 For every one that doeth evil hateth the light, neither cometh to the light, lest his deeds should be reproved.
21 But he that doeth truth cometh to the light, that his deeds may be made manifest, that they are wrought in God.
Natural light reveals natural things. Spiritual light reveals spiritual things. The Light that came into the world represented by the Person of Jesus Christ, Who is Himself the Light testified of the evil that was and is present in this world (JOHN 7:7); evil born of fallen angels as well as sinful humanity. With absolute certainty, this condemnation - this judgment of God, will fall upon all who reject the Light that is Christ (ROM 5:16, 18).

JOHN 3:14-16
14 And as Moses lifted up the serpent in the wilderness, even so must the Son of man be lifted up:
15 That whosoever believeth in him should not perish, but have eternal life.
16 For God so loved the world, that he gave his only begotten Son, that whosoever believeth in him should not perish, but have everlasting life.
It was at the fall of man that Adam and Eve were told by God Himself, that the "seed" of the woman would crush the serpent's head, and that the serpent would bruise the heel of this One who was to come (GEN 3:15). This declaration was no doubt heralded to all generations that was to come. So much so, that in the fallen state, people began to pervert the message and conceive of their own 'savior' which in turn spawned all sorts of Messiah-wanna be's among the religions of the world (typically, anti-Christ figures and vulgar replacements).
